核心结论:TPWallet(以下简称TP)最新版是可以进行“授权”的——包括连接dApp、签名交易与设置代币批准(allowance)。但“能授权”不等于“安全无虞”。本文从授权机制、安全防护(含防CSRF)、智能化数字化转型、专家预测、未来科技创新、跨链协议与账户备份七个维度进行综合分析,并给出可执行的安全建议。
1) 授权机制与风险
- 授权类型:连接钱包(wallet connect/网页注入)、交易签名、代币批准(ERC20 approve)与合约交互权限。TP作为非托管钱包,私钥控制在用户端,操作需用户确认。
- 风险点:恶意dApp或钓鱼站点发起签名/approve 请求、无限期授权导致代币被转移、长期授权合同存在逻辑漏洞。
2) 防CSRF攻击(跨站请求伪造)
- 本质:CSRF主要针对基于cookie的会话;区块链签名流程虽有天然防护,但前端仍可能被利用发送未经用户同意的授权请求或引导用户误签名。
- 建议防护措施:
- 钱包端:显著展示请求来源域名、请求摘要与交易影响(转账金额、代币合约、spender地址);对敏感操作要求二次确认或PIN/生物认证;对来自内嵌iframe或跨域上下文的请求提高警示或默认拒绝。
- dApp端:采用挑战-响应签名(nonce+时间戳),不要依赖cookie自动登录;前端使用SameSite=strict、CSRF token、并避免在公用页面自动触发签名请求。
- 用户端:在未知网站上不要自动批准连接或签名;优先使用硬件钱包/受保护的浏览器环境。
3) 智能化与数字化转型
- TP可通过AI与自动化提升安全与体验:实时风险评分(基于合约行为、历史黑名单)、可视化权限分析(展示approve影响范围)、智能提示(建议最小授权额度或一次性授权)。
- 企业级应用侧可借助钱包SDK整合KYC、策略管理与自动审计,实现从“手工批准”向“策略驱动的自动化审批”转型。
4) 专家预测(短中长期)
- 短期:钱包将增强UI对权限细节的可读性,推出一键撤销/限制approve的工具。
- 中期:普及基于阈值签名、多签与社交恢复的账户模型,减少单点私钥风险。AI将被用于异常行为检测与自动提示。
- 长期:账户抽象(account abstraction)、零知识证明与MPC广泛落地,用户体验接近传统Web2登录但安全性更高。
5) 未来科技创新(对钱包的影响)
- 多方计算(MPC)与阈值签名:降低硬件依赖,支持云+设备混合保护。
- 零知识证明与隐私协议:在不暴露隐私的前提下实现可验证授权。
- 智能合约可升级性与形式化验证:减少合约级别的授权滥用风险。
6) 跨链协议与授权管理
- 挑战:不同链的代币授权标准、桥的信任模型与跨链消息中继带来额外风险。
- 趋势:采用标准化的授权元数据、链间审计与去中心化中继(如IBC、去信任桥)可以降低被桥利用的攻击面。钱包应对跨链批准提供链上下文提示并限制跨链approve权限的默认范围。
7) 账户备份与恢复
- 传统方案:助记词(mnemonic)、私钥、硬件钱包备份。务必离线保存助记词,防止云端明文存储。

- 进阶方案:Shamir分片(多份存储)、社交恢复、多签钱包、加密云备份(带硬件根密钥)等。TP若支持社交恢复或与硬件集成,可显著提高恢复友好性与安全性。
实用建议(给普通用户):
- 授权前先核验域名与合约地址,谨慎对“无限期/无限额” approve说不;优选一次性或限额授权。
- 使用硬件钱包或启用TP的PIN/生物认证功能;对高价值操作使用多签或社交恢复策略。
- 定期使用链上工具(如revoke服务、区块浏览器)审计并撤销不必要的授权。

- 在公共网络或不可信设备上不要导入助记词。启用备份分片或离线存储。
结论:TPWallet最新版具备授权能力,但安全性取决于钱包实现的防护、用户操作习惯和dApp的健壮性。结合防CSRF策略、智能化风险检测、跨链安全实践与可靠的账户备份方案,可以在保证便利性的同时大幅降低授权风险。未来,MPC、账户抽象与AI驱动风控将进一步改变钱包授权的安全边界。
评论
Tech_Liu
很实用的分析,尤其是关于CSRF和approve的细节提醒,已经去检查了我的授权列表。
小白问号
请问TP支持社交恢复吗?文章提到的分片备份有具体教程吗?
CryptoAnna
对跨链授权的风险描述很到位,希望钱包能尽快提供一键撤销功能。
王勇
专家预测部分让人安心,期待MPC和账户抽象普及后更安全的用户体验。